Symptoms

Consider the following scenario:

  • You enable Enhanced Protected Mode (EPM) in Windows Internet Explorer 11.

  • You go to a website, and the identity provider (idP) of the website is in a different sandbox than the website. For example, login.live.com is in a different sandbox than bing.com.

  • The website requires that EPM is enabled in Internet Explorer 11.

In this scenario, you may encounter cookie-related issues. For example, you cannot sign in to the website, or your personal information is not loaded correctly after you sign in.

Cause

This issue occurs because cookies are not shared when the idP and the website are in different sandboxes.

Resolution

Update information

To resolve this issue, install the most recent cumulative security update for Internet Explorer. To do this, go to Microsoft Update.

For technical information about the most recent cumulative security update for Internet Explorer, go to the following Microsoft website:

http://www.microsoft.com/technet/security/current.aspxNote This update was first included in security update 2888505.
